Good morning Dr Wicks, As a parent I wanted to share some exciting news with you. Jabari Williams(8th Grade) will be playing in National Basketball Tournament in July down in the ESPN Arena, Orlando, FL. Jabari’s team won the AAU South East Georgia Elite Super Regional Tournament (8thGrade), this past weekend. The reason I wanted to share this information with you is because it all started with playing for your basketball team this past season that he was recognized by some coaches from Bluffton who asked that he come and try out for the team. The Carolina Ballers is an AAU traveling team that is based out of Bluffton, that is part of the Boys and Girls Club. There were a total of 72 young men who tried out for this team, some of which were a part of the Royal Knights. Only 12 were selected. Royal Live Oaks should be proud that when coaches from other areas approach him, he doesn’t hesitate to let them know that he is a Royal Knight.
